Real estate team donates $6,500 to hospital foundation MRI campaign

Faris Team is donating $100 from each home sold in Collingwood toward the hospital's new MRI machine

Alison Smith and Brad Miller from the CGMH Foundation receive the donation from Faris team members: Steve Vieira, Director of Sales, Monica Alvarado, Amanda Carmichael, Luke Watson, Ivana Famele and Alex Moncayo-Fex.

Faris Team, an area real estate brokerage, recently gave the Collingwood General and Marine Hospital Foundation a cheque for $6,500, which is earmarked for the current MRI campaign. 

Collingwood's hospital received word from the provincial government in December that it would receive operating funds for a new MRI lab on site. However, the hospital foundation is responsible for raising the funds needed to buy the MRI and to renovate a space in the hospital to build the lab for it. The government funding is for annual operating costs only. 

The Faris Team has pledged to donate $100 from each home its team sells in Collingwood toward the hospital foundation's MRI campaign.
